It was the Spring Awakening set with a few extra props and pictures on the wall.

The house was packed, and lots and lots of Broadway names. Was a couple seats over from Ashley Brown. Lots of Mermaid folks all around, Rosie O'Donnell, Brian Stokes Mitchell, and many more. A very exciting night and Sherie got a well-deserved extended standing ovation at the end.
